Xbox one s 4k on Hdmi 1.4 monitor?

Omxp

hi,  I have a benq monitor with HDMI 1.4 input and DisplayPort, will xbox one s HDMI 2.0a work with my monitor to play games on 4k resolution?

 

or should I use a signal converter and use the displayport?

HDMI 1.4a cant hande 4k at 60fps. IF your monitor supports 4k at 60hz over DisplayPort you will need to use that to get 60hz on 4k with xbox ones s.

All HDMI versions are compatible with each other, it will work fine, but only up to 4K 30 Hz.

1 hour ago, Omxp said:

will a converter work from xbox one s hdmi 2.0a output to a dispalyport?

No one makes these converters. People only make DisplayPort to HDMI 2.0 converters, not the other way around.
